contractsaperr.go 1.3 KB

12345678910111213141516171819202122232425262728293031323334
  1. package model
  2. import "time"
  3. type ContractSapErr struct {
  4. ID int64 `gorm:"column:id;primary_key"`
  5. ContractID int `gorm:"column:contractId"`
  6. PastureID int `gorm:"column:pastureId"`
  7. PastureName string `gorm:"column:pastureName"`
  8. PartID int `gorm:"column:partId"`
  9. PartName string `gorm:"column:partName"`
  10. PartCode string `gorm:"column:partCode"`
  11. Specification string `gorm:"column:specification"`
  12. Price float64 `gorm:"column:price"`
  13. BrandID int `gorm:"column:brandId"`
  14. Brand string `gorm:"column:brand"`
  15. InventoryType int `gorm:"column:inventoryType"`
  16. PlanAmount string `gorm:"column:planAmount"`
  17. Remark string `gorm:"column:remark"`
  18. Enable int `gorm:"column:enable"`
  19. Unit string `gorm:"column:unit"`
  20. IsZeroStock int `gorm:"column:isZeroStock"`
  21. ChangeID int `gorm:"column:changeId"`
  22. TaxCode string `gorm:"column:taxcode"`
  23. IsToSap int `gorm:"column:isToSap"`
  24. SapText string `gorm:"column:sapText"`
  25. PushStatus int `gorm:"column:pushstatus"`
  26. ContractCode string `gorm:"column:contractCode"`
  27. CreateTime time.Time `gorm:"column:createTime"`
  28. }
  29. func (ContractSapErr) TableName() string {
  30. return "contractsaperr"
  31. }